P.S. to new or wannabe webmasters. Don't assume "hits" are the all-important thing.

Your unique visits are the ones that count. As best I understand it, and someone correct me if I'm wrong -- but your hits include any and every file that is viewed via your domain. In other words, if you have graphics storage hotlinked to other sites, they count as hits. If 1 of your web pages has 1 CSS file, 1 JS file and 17 Graphics...that counts as 20 hits (including the page itself).

Unique visits is a better measure.

Repeat visitors is even better.

And do take some serious time to analyze any search engine results, especially keywords, because that will tell you what people were looking for when they arrived at your site. If you are not marketing to what your viewers are looking for, you're missing the boat.
